Abstract
In this paper the concept of Simultaneous Coded Emission in the context of Coherent ultrasound Plane Wave Compounding (SCE-CPWC) is studied. The constraints under which SCE-CPWC was proven to be effective are released and we show that a good estimation of the insonified medium can be obtained using l1-regularization. Simulation results on medium with sparse and dense distribution of scatterers are presented and discussed.
